Creamy Homemade Rose Ice Cream

Creamy Homemade Rose Ice Cream - A Floral Indulgence to Savor

This Creamy Homemade Rose Ice Cream is a delightful treat that blends creamy richness with enchanting floral notes, perfect for dessert lovers.
Prep Time 35 minutes
Freezing Time 4 hours
Total Time 4 hours 35 minutes
Servings: 6 scoops
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: Floral
Calories: 250

Ingredients
  

For the Base
  • 2 cups Whole Milk Using full-fat ensures a rich flavor.
  • 3/4 cup White Sugar Feel free to substitute your favorite sweetener.
  • 2 cups Heavy Whipping Cream Essential for achieving a creamy texture.
  • 1 tablespoon Pure Vanilla Extract Opt for pure for a more authentic taste.
For the Flavor
  • 2-3 tablespoons Rose Water Adjust according to desired floral intensity.
  • 1 drop Pink Food Coloring (optional) Use sparingly to achieve a soft pink shade.
Optional Add-Ins
  • 1 cup Pureed Berries Pairs beautifully with the floral notes.
  • 1/2 cup Chopped Pistachios Fold in for a delightful crunch.
  • 1 teaspoon Lavender Extract Use in moderation to avoid overpowering.

Equipment

  • Ice cream maker

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. In a mixing bowl, whisk together 2 cups of whole milk, 3/4 cup of white sugar, and 1 tablespoon of pure vanilla extract for 2-3 minutes.
  2. Stir in 2 cups of heavy whipping cream and 2-3 tablespoons of rose water. Mix gently for 1-2 minutes.
  3. If desired, add a few drops of pink food coloring and stir until evenly distributed.
  4. Pour the mixture into a pre-chilled ice cream maker and churn according to the manufacturer's instructions for 20-25 minutes.
  5. Transfer the churned ice cream into an airtight container, smooth the top, and place it in the freezer for at least 4 hours.
  6. Before serving, let it sit at room temperature for 5-10 minutes to soften slightly.

Notes

Ensure to measure your rose water carefully to avoid overwhelming flavor. Chill your ice cream maker bowl for a creamier texture.
